
Pratyush Biswas contributed to the contentstack/live-preview-sdk by building and refining collaboration features in the Visual Builder, focusing on UI reliability and workflow hygiene. He implemented automatic cleanup of empty collaboration threads and enhanced comment thread visuals for better responsiveness and alignment. Using React, TypeScript, and CSS, Pratyush introduced dynamic mention suggestion list positioning to prevent overflow, improved cursor placement accuracy, and added robust input validation for comment fields. His work included comprehensive automated tests and targeted bug fixes, resulting in a more stable and maintainable codebase. These efforts improved both developer experience and end-user collaboration within the SDK.

March 2025 monthly summary for contentstack/live-preview-sdk: Implemented dynamic Mention Suggestion List Positioning for Comments to prevent overflow and improve UX; refined cursor position calculations for accurate placement; fixed a list overflow edge case to enhance stability across viewports. These changes reduce UI glitches in mention suggestions and contribute to a smoother commenting experience in live preview scenarios.

January 2025 — Monthly work summary for contentstack/live-preview-sdk: Delivered two collaboration-focused improvements in the Visual Builder and strengthened reliability with test coverage. Features delivered: (1) Automatic cleanup of collaboration threads when the last comment is deleted, ensuring no-comment threads are removed and onDeleteThread is invoked as expected (commit 5f8c184ab26044bd07a2e220a2f97ddf5d0e85b7). (2) Visual improvements for collaboration thread comments—enhanced text overflow handling, alignment of user details, and overall responsiveness (commit ecfde0ae403807c7e36461e3777d0a720eb82ae1). Additional related work includes tests for deletion scenarios (commit 7cce06f1f884aa737ff33ae0d3d4e6e094b05093) and UI styling refinements (commit ecfde0ae). Major bugs fixed: addressed edge-case cleanup of empty threads to prevent orphaned threads and added test coverage to validate onDeleteThread behavior. Overall impact: improved data hygiene in collaboration workflows, more reliable UI behavior in the Visual Builder, and reduced risk of regressions through automated tests. Technologies/skills demonstrated: test-driven development, refactoring for UI/UX polish, CSS and styling adjustments, and robust commit hygiene across features and tests.
